Output 0af62dbf6ac8266b576f05ca6ee95da95b90043284159b5551159f9eef0340f4:0

value
44578
script pubkey
OP_0 OP_PUSHBYTES_20 37ed05d1298e100b248699850e5016cda2016f1e
address
bc1qxlkst5ff3cgqkfyxnxzsu5qkek3qzmc7wk50ga
transaction
0af62dbf6ac8266b576f05ca6ee95da95b90043284159b5551159f9eef0340f4
confirmations
388386
spent
true